**Q3 Planning Note — Support Outsourcing**

Finance team: the Callowell support outsourcing plan proceeds. Tier-1 tickets move to the Renmark facility by October; projected savings of 18% on support opex. Headcount adjustments handled via attrition. Budget lines updated in the next forecast cycle. The strategic rationale behind this move is summarized below.

confidential, kagup-bafog: Fraaxax Group is in early talks to buy Soroxox Group for about $343.8 million. The Olidor launch date is June 14, and nothing goes to the press before then. Legal wants the Aldmirek Logistics term sheet signed before July 23.

// Client for Duskpanel, the theming service behind the admin
// dashboard's dark-mode toggle. Fetches palette tokens at boot;
// caches for 10 min. Don't hardcode colors — everything comes
// from Duskpanel or the fallback light theme. Requests are
// authenticated with the service key below.

gateway credential: kto23_LX9A4ys6i4nzHtpOLNLodKK

Subject: Key rotation — Lattixa timetable solver

Team,

We rotated the internal API key for the Lattixa solver backend tonight after the quarterly audit flagged stale credentials. Old key dies at 06:00 tomorrow. On-call: update the scheduler worker config and restart the periodics pool. Timetable regeneration jobs will fail loudly if you miss it. No schema changes, no other action needed. The new key is below.

API key for tagef-fafop: vxb2-ta

## Service Accounts: Pool Manager Notes (for weekly sync)

Quick recap for Thursday: the `svc-poolwatch` account now owns connection pooling for the Harborline databases. It caps each app at 40 connections and recycles idle ones after five minutes, which already cut our "too many clients" pages to basically zero. If you need pool metrics or want to tweak limits, hit the PoolWatch admin API — it authenticates with the key below.

gateway credential: kto7_GoY89Me

### Step 4: Shard the Profile Store

Okay, the fun part. Quibble's user-profile table is getting split across four shards, keyed on account hash. Run the backfill script first — it's idempotent, so re-running after a crash is fine. Once the backfill finishes, flip the router flag and watch the dual-write metrics for an hour before killing the legacy path. The router needs the following settings before you flip anything.

config for bawig-fadup:
[zorix]
host = zorix.lumicworks.corp
user = zorix_svc
database = zorix_prod